Gavin Cecchini was honored by MiLB as the Pacific Coast League Player of the Week. Cecchini earned the honors after hitting .440/.517/.840 with two home runs and driving in 10. He also walked four times, hit four doubles and scored six runs. His 21 total bases set the pace for the entire organization.
His best performance came on Sunday night when he knocked in four runs and hit his fourth homer of the season. Today, he was also named to MLB Pipeline’s prospect team of the week.
He joins teammates Rafael Montero and T.J. Rivera as 51s to the receive player of the week award during the 2016 season. Rivera was also named the player of the month for May.
On the season Gavin, the #4 ranked prospect here at MMN, has a slash line of .328/.393/.460 with four HR, 31 R and 29 RBI. Even though the SS has struggled in the field, with 20 errors in 249 total chances, there is the possibility he starts to be utilized in a utility role to help the big league club.
